ABSTRACT:
A method and apparatus for determining the effective bits of resolution of a digitizer wherein amplitude, frequency, phase angle and offset parameters characterizing a sinewave input signal to the digitizer are estimated from the waveform data sequence produced by the digitizer in response to the input signal. These estimated parameters are used to develop a model of the sinewave signal, and the effective bits of resolution of the digitizer are then determined by the comparing measured magnitudes of the sinewave signal as represented by the waveform data sequence to estimated magnitudes of the input signal being determined from the model.
